AA to BBA (Lamar University) 2020-2021

TRANSFER PATHWAY
(For Transfer to Lamar University)
ASSOCIATE OF ARTS WITH A FIELD OF STUDY IN BUSINESS ADMINISTRATION AND MANAGEMENT TO
BACHELOR OF BUSINESS ADMINISTRATION IN BUSINESS

Catalog Year: 2020-2021 (You may use this pathway if you entered Dallas College on or before this date.) 

Career Path: Business, Hospitality and Global Trade

Available at: Brookhaven, Eastfield, El Centro, Mountain View, North Lake and Richland Campuses

TSI: Must be Complete

SEMESTER-BY-SEMESTER MAP FOR FULL-TIME STUDENTS

Although there may be several options to fulfill certain requirements for the associate’s degree, please note that this pathway lists the specific courses leading to this bachelor’s degree. All plans can be modified to fit the needs of part-time students. This is not an official degree plan. Refer to catalog for official degree requirements. You must receive a GPA of at least 2.00 on all college-level course work. Students must earn at least 25% of the credit hours required for graduation through instruction by Dallas College. Certain courses for this program are only offered at the Brookhaven Campus, Eastfield Campus, El Centro Campus, Mountain View Campus, North Lake Campus and Richland Campus. Contact your advisor for information.

AA FOS DEGREE MINIMUM: 60 SEMESTER CREDIT HOURS

SEMESTER 1 (Total Hours: 13)

  • ENGL 1301 – Composition I This is a (CB 010) Core course. Must earn a grade of “C” or higher.
  • HIST 1301 – United States History I This is a (CB 060) Core course.
  • MATH 1324 – Mathematics for Business & Social Sciences This is a (CB 020) Core course. Must earn a grade of “C” or higher.
  • CHOOSE ONE:
    • SPCH 1315 – Public Speaking OR
      SPCH 1321
      – Business and Professional Communication These are (CB 090) Core courses.
  • PHED 1164 – Introduction to Physical Fitness and Wellness This is a (CB 090) Core course.

SEMESTER 2 (Total Hours: 15)

  • ENGL 1302 – Composition II This is a (CB 010) Core course.
  • HIST 1302 – United States History II This is a (CB 060) Core course. There are several options to fulfill this requirement. Contact your academic advisor for a specific list.
  • BUSI 1301 – Business Principles This is a Field of Study course.
  • ECON 2302 – Principles of Microeconomics This is a Field of Study course.
  • BCIS 1305 – Business Computer Applications This is a Field of Study course.

SEMESTER 3 (Total Hours: 16)

  • BIOL 1408 – Biology for Non-Science Majors I This is a (CB 030) Core course. There are several options to fulfill this requirement. Contact your academic advisor for a specific list.
  • GOVT 2305 – Federal Government This is a (CB 070) Core course.
  • ENGL 2332 – World Literature I This is a (CB 040) Core course. There are several options to fulfill this requirement. Contact your academic advisor for a specific list.
  • ACCT 2301 – Principles of Financial Accounting This is a Field of Study course.
  • ECON 2301 – Principles of Macroeconomics This is a (CB 080) Core course.

SEMESTER 4 (Total Hours: 16)

  • BIOL 1409 – Biology for Non-Science Majors II This is a (CB 030) Core course. There are several options to fulfill this requirement. Contact your academic advisor for a specific list.
  • GOVT 2306 – Texas Government This is a (CB 070) Core course.
  • BUSI 2305 – Business Statistics This is a Field of Study course.
  • ACCT 2302 – Principles of Managerial Accounting This is a Field of Study course.
  • ARTS 1301 – Art Appreciation This is a (CB 050) Core course. There are several options to fulfill this requirement. Contact your academic advisor for a specific list.

LAMAR UNIVERSITY
(For Transfer From Dallas College)
ASSOCIATE OF ARTS WITH A FIELD OF STUDY IN BUSINESS ADMINISTRATION AND MANAGEMENT TO
BACHELOR OF BUSINESS ADMINISTRATION IN BUSINESS

SEMESTER-BY-SEMESTER MAP FOR FULL-TIME STUDENTS

For questions about the Lamar University portion of this transfer pathway, contact Leslie Hederman in the Undergraduate Advising Office at 409-880-7216 or transferadvocate@lamar.edu. It is best to apply to Lamar University a full semester before you plan to transfer. It will help if you submit a copy of this pathway with your application.

SEMESTER 1 (Total Hours: 15)

  • BULW 3310 – Business Law
  • BUSI 2300 – Intro to Critical Thinking for Business Decisions
  • BUAL 3320 – Business Analysis II
  • MKTG 3310 – Principles of Marketing
  • CHOOSE ONE:
    • ACCT 3340 – Cost Accounting OR
    • ACCT 3380 – Taxation Accounting I

SEMESTER 2 (Total Hours: 15)

  • BCOM 3350 – Business Communication
  • MGMT 3320 – Production Management
  • MGMT 3310 – Prin of Organizational Behavior & Management
  • MISY 3310 – Principles of MIS
  • FINC 3310 – Principles of Finance

SEMESTER 3 (Total Hours: 15)

  • FINC 3320 – Intermediate Financial Management
  • BULW 4390 – Special Topics in Business Law
  • MGMT 3330 – Human Resource Management
  • ECON 3340/3390 – Macro Economics
  • CHOOSE ONE:
    • MGMT 3340 Project Management OR
    • MGMT 4340 – Quality and Productivity Management

SEMESTER 4 (Total Hours: 15)

  • MGMT 4370 – Strategic Analysis
  • MGMT 4380 – Seminar of Entrepreneurship
  • MKTG 4310 – Marketing Management
  • Upper Level Business Elective
  • Upper Level Business Elective
